Why schedule representative matches on the same night?
Fri May 8, 2009
by Steve Kaless
Source: The Roar

The ARL might be a little miffed that the ANZAC Test has been somewhat overshadowed by the itchy feet of the last placed NRL club. But they may only have themselves to blame.

By scheduling the Test on the same night as the City Vs Country game, they've already taken away some of the spotlight.

In fact, there seems to be more interest than normal in the City Vs Country match, which is probably down to the fact that it is being seen as a genuine Origin trial for plenty of jumpers (given the fact that Queensland nearly makes up the entire Australian side).

This is something that those of us with more than half a brain have been banging on about for years. If the City Vs Country match is to have any point, it needs to be as a proper trial.

Remember when a certain analyst, who is constantly declaring he knows best and has the game's best interests at heart, especially those of bush footy, wanted all Origin players quarantined from the match, instantly turning it into a farce?

So hopefully we will learn something from the exercise.

Another thing we should learn is not to have such ridiculous clashes with representative football.

All rugby league eyes should be on the Test match, especially given its billing as a rematch of the World Cup final (although New Zealand don't have to give the trophy back if they lose).

But to have it on the same night as City Vs Country just dilutes it.

Of course, it does give Channel Nine a cracking double header. I hope they remember it at the next broadcast deal.

But what also dilutes it is when the new coach says, "I'll be picking on form," when what he really means is, "It will be the same old stagers".

Why doesn't every new coach feel the need to make a variation of the "reputations mean nothing" statement?

Rather than picking blokes in form, Sheens has gone for the novel approach of going with some players dramatically out of form.

Paul Gallen? Fair enough when the Sharks were firing, but what about when they are coming last. And he has already missed a few games on suspension.

Glen Stewart, Anthony Watmough and Brent Kite have all been pretty average for the Sea Eagles this year. Watmough's defence against Melbourne last Friday was barely of first grade standard.

As debated on this site earlier this week, it isn't like there aren't plenty of other candidates.

Of course, against a New Zealand side that has Dene Halatau at hooker, it should make it all academic.

But we've heard that before, haven't we.

Fittler's request, Geyer's Shark rescue, Barrett's comeback and more
Wed April 29, 2009
by Steve Mascord
SYDNEY Roosters coach Brad Fittler has this morning made a remarkable request: that representative selectors ignore the claims of several of his star players.

Fittler tells Rugby League Week today that if the likes of Braith Anasta, Willie Mason, Craig Fitzgibbon and Mark O'Meley are no hope of playing for New South Wales then it is pointless picking them for City-Country.

"If guys aren't being seriously considered for NSW, then this is probably a game for blooding young players,'' Fittler exclusively comments in RLW.

"If these players were left out for being so-called 'past it' then picking them for City-Country would seem to be contradictory to what representative football is all about.

"If they do get chosen, I'm sure they'll do their best and they will go with the club's full blessing but I thought all rep teams were picked with an eye on the future.''

Elsewhere, columnist Mark Geyer weighs into the Ricky Stuart-Phil Gould stoush by outlining how he would help struggling Cronulla.

"I can understand why Ricky wouldn't want Gus around but with the wooden spoon already in the mailing centre awaiting delivery to the Shire, maybe it's time he looked to someone different,'' Geyer writes.

"Someone like me?''

Sharks five-eighth Trent Barrett, meanwhile, is in line for a shock return to representative football after a four-year absence.

And the biggest surprise is that the comeback is set to be as Country's starting halfback, ahead of Newcastle gun Jarrod Mullen. The magazine says Barrett has considerable support from selectors and Laurie Daley's coaching staff going into this weekend's matches.

Chairman of selectors Jock Colley says: "Despite Trent being overlooked by NSW we think he still has plenty to offer Country.

"He will be strongly considered for our side.''

Manly have copped a bucketing from one of their own, 1982 Kangaroos skipper Max Krilich saying: "It's the props who need to lift.

"(Brent) Kite and (Josh) Perry haven't been going forward and making the territory and it needs to change - they have to do their job.''

Queensland chairman of selectors Des Morris, meanwhile, has revealed the Maroons could use all three of their gun fullbacks - Billy Slater, Karmichael Hunt and Matt Bowen - in the same side during this year's State of Origin series against NSW.

North Queensland's Bowen missed out on the preliminary Maroons squad named last night but Morris tells RLW he has rocketed back into contention in recent weeks.

Round Eight star Jamie Soward tells RLW how Wayne Bennett helped him exorcise his demons and Bulldogs coach Kevin Moore has guaranteed veteran winger Hazem El Masri his spot as long as he holds his current form.
